Commercial Slab Construction in Toledo, OH

Commercial slab construction services involve the creation of concrete foundations that support various types of commercial buildings, including warehouses, retail centers, office complexes, and industrial facilities. These projects typically require a sturdy, level, and durable concrete slab that can withstand heavy loads and provide a stable base for construction. Property owners seeking these services usually want to understand the scope of the project, including site preparation, concrete quality, and the specific design requirements to ensure the foundation meets the needs of their commercial space.

Before requesting commercial slab construction, property owners should consider factors such as the size and layout of the project, the type of commercial structure being built, and any local building codes or regulations that may apply. It is also helpful to understand the soil conditions of the site, as they can impact the foundation’s stability and longevity. Clear communication about project expectations, load requirements, and timeline can help ensure the construction process aligns with the overall goals of the property development or renovation.

Project Types

Common Commercial Slab Construction Jobs

Commercial slab foundations provide a stable base for various types of commercial buildings and structures.

Parking lot slabs are designed to withstand vehicle traffic and heavy loads for retail or industrial properties.

Warehouse flooring offers a durable surface suitable for storage facilities and distribution centers.

Sidewalk and walkway slabs enhance accessibility and safety around commercial properties.

Loading dock slabs support heavy equipment and frequent freight handling activities.

Industrial slab construction ensures long-lasting, level surfaces for manufacturing and processing plants.

FAQ

Commercial Slab Construction Questions

What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ces in commercial properties.

What materials are used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the primary material, often reinforced with steel to provide strength and durability for heavy loads and high traffic areas.

How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ness varies based on the intended use, but typically ranges from 4 to 12 inches to support different types of loads and structures.

What should property owners consider before construction? Proper site preparation, soil conditions, and drainage are essential factors to ensure the longevity and performance of a commercial slab.
